Abstract
The present invention provides a kind of face silk resurfacing welding materials, contain following component in percentage by weight:C 0.03~0.1%;P≤0.025%;S≤0.03%;Si 0.3~0.5%;Mn 1.3~1.8%;Ni 3~5%;Cr 10~15%;Ba 1~3%;Mo 0.5~1.2%;W 1~2%;V 2~4%;Nb 1~3%;Ce2O30.1~0.3%;Co 0.5~1.2%;Ti 1~3%;Re 0.2~0.5%;Surplus is Fe.Built-up welding is carried out using Continuous Casting Rolls bottom surface provided by the invention resurfacing welding material, overlay cladding has excellent anti-fatigue performance, good anticorrosive and wear-resisting property, and overlay cladding simulation Continuous Casting Rolls 1000 cyclic tests of rapid heat cycle find no fatigue crack.Available for various steel rolls, Heat Working Rolls, Continuous Casting Rolls, crane roller, blast furnace top bell sealing surface.

Background technology
It is an important branch in welding field that built-up welding, which remanufactures, is a kind of sufacing processing method, it is
One layer of technical process with certain performance materials is applied in piece surface heap using welding manner.Waste and old Heavy Back-Up Roll is carried out
Rebuilding engineering processing, can excavate the huge surplus value, and the cost for remanufacturing new product is about the 50% of original, and use the longevity
Life can meet or exceed original, and can reduce by more than 60% energy consumption, save more than 70% material.Therefore built-up welding remanufactures large size
Metallurgical backing roll can significantly emission reduction, it is energy saving and consumption reduction, have apparent resource, environmental protection and social benefit, have it is sustainable
Development prospect.
Invention content
To solve the above problems, the invention discloses a kind of face silk resurfacing welding materials.
In order to reach object above, the present invention provides following technical solution:
A kind of face silk resurfacing welding material, contains following component in percentage by weight:C 0.03~0.1%;P ≤
0.025%;S ≤0.03%;Si 0.3~0.5%;Mn 1.3~1.8%;Ni 3~5%;Cr 10~15%;Ba 1~3%;Mo
0.5~1.2%;W 1~2%;V 2~4%;Nb 1~3%;Ce2O30.1~0.3%;Co 0.5~1.2%;Ti 1~3%;Re
0.2~0.5%;Surplus is Fe.
Preferably, face silk resurfacing welding material contains following component in percentage by weight:C 0.04~0.06%;P ≤
0.025%;S ≤0.03%;Si 0.4~0.5%;Mn 1.4~1.6%;Ni 3~4%;Cr 12~14%;Ba 1.5~2%;Mo
0.8~1%;W 1.5~1.8%;V 3~3.5%;Nb 2~2.6%;Ce2O30.2~0.25%;Co 0.9~1%;Ti 1.5~
2%;Re 0.3~0.4%;Surplus is Fe.
Above-mentioned Continuous Casting Rolls bottom surface resurfacing welding material, is made by following steps:
(1)Each raw material is weighed according to the ratio in formula, ball mill is put into and is ground and mixes, obtain mixed-powder;
(2)Mixed-powder is put into dryer and carries out drying and processing;
(3)Select the steel band of width 12~16mm, 0.4~0.6mm of thickness, steel band is pressed into it is U-shaped, by the powder after drying
End is put into the U-type groove of steel band, and steel band then is rolled into section for O shape welding wire base pipes;
(4)With multi-joint linear drawing machine by welding wire base pipe drawing to finished product welding wire.
Preferably, step(2)Middle drying temperature is 120~160 DEG C, and drying time is 1~3h.
It, can be with SJ-1A solder flux or HRC40. when carrying out built-up welding using Continuous Casting Rolls bottom surface provided by the invention resurfacing welding material
Solder flux is used cooperatively, available for various steel rolls, Heat Working Rolls, Continuous Casting Rolls, crane roller, blast furnace top bell sealing surface.
What the present invention obtained has the beneficial effect that:
Built-up welding is carried out using Continuous Casting Rolls bottom surface provided by the invention resurfacing welding material, overlay cladding has excellent fatigue resistance
Can, good anticorrosive and wear-resisting property, overlay cladding simulation Continuous Casting Rolls 1000 cyclic tests of rapid heat cycle find no fatigue
Crackle.Available for various steel rolls, Heat Working Rolls, Continuous Casting Rolls, crane roller, blast furnace top bell sealing surface.
